The separation/purification of mixtures of gases with related physical properties is a difficult task. Examples are CO2/C2H2 or cyclohexane/benzene mixtures which possess similar sublimation and boiling points (Table 1). In this regard, PCP’s pore size and shape can be modulated in order to carry out these difficult separation processes in an efficient way.[1] In this communication, we show the structural characterisation, adsorptive, ion exchange, separation and catalytic properties of the anionic MOF NH4[Cu3(µ3-OH)(µ3-4-carboxypyrazolato)3] (NH4@1).
